Abstract

The present invention is directed to a system and method for managing state information related to an interactive application to accommodate one or more users participating in an interactive application session, wherein the state information comprises local state information specific to each of the one or more user's unique view of the interactive application and global state information. The system of the present invention may comprise a telecommunications network; an application server in communication with the telecommunications network for managing the global state information relative to all of the users participating in the interactive application session; and at least one mobile client device in communication with the application server over the telecommunications network for managing the local state information for each of the one or more users. The method of the present invention may comprise the steps of structuring the state information for optimized delivery over the telecommunications network; and transferring the state information over the telecommunications network.

Claims (33)

1. A system to manage a transfer of state information for an interactive application session between at least one mobile client device and an application server having a mobile game server over a telecommunications network, the application server having a hardware processing device to:

compare local state information received from the at least one mobile client device to global state information related to the interactive application session, wherein difference between the local state information and the global state information comprise changed state information;

structure the changed state information for optimized delivery over the telecommunications network, wherein structuring includes

determining an initial set of instructions for describing the changed state information based on at least one system parameter and mapping at least one degree of freedom associated with an interactive application to the initial set of instructions necessary to render the state information over the telecommunications network, and

minimizing the initial set of instructions to achieve an efficient configuration of the state information;

communicate the structured state information over the telecommunications network; and

update the global state information based on the structured changed state information received from the at least one mobile client device.

2. The system of claim 1 , wherein the telecommunication network comprising a wireless communication network.

3. The system of claim 1 , further comprising a global modeler to update global state information of the state information by comparing local state information of the state information with the global state information.

4. The system of claim 3 , wherein the global state information is updated based on the degrees of freedom associated with the interactive application.

5. The system of claim 3 , wherein the processing device is further to deliver the updated global state information to the at least one mobile client device.
